Q: What's special about GMC diesel repair?
A: GMC diesel engines (like the Duramax) require specialized service and maintenance. Common issues include fuel injector problems, turbocharger issues, and EGR valve problems. Our ASE-certified technicians have extensive experience with GMC diesel engines.
Q: How often should I service my GMC truck?
A: GMC trucks should follow the manufacturer's recommended maintenance schedule, which typically includes oil changes every 5,000-10,000 miles, transmission service every 30,000-60,000 miles, and suspension inspections regularly. Regular maintenance keeps your truck reliable.
Q: What should I know about GMC transmission problems?
A: Some GMC models have known transmission issues, particularly with automatic transmissions. Common symptoms include rough shifting, hesitation, or slipping. If you notice transmission problems, bring your GMC in for inspection. Early diagnosis can prevent costly repairs.
